Write the IUPAC name of the given compound:

$\begin{matrix} HO-C{ H } _{ 2 } \ - & CH &-C{ H } _{ 2 }-OH \  & | &  \  & C{ H } _{ 3 } &  \end{matrix}$

  1. 2-Methylpropane-1,3-diol

  2. 2-Methylpropan-1,3-dial

  3. 1-Hydroxy-2-methylpropan-1-ol

  4. None of these

Reveal answer Fill a bubble to check yourself
A Correct answer
Explanation

The given compound can be numbered from left to right or vice versa. At the 2nd position, there is a methyl group and is designated as 2-Methyl. 


The parent carbon chain contains 3 carbon atoms resembling propane and at the positions 1 and 3, there's the hydroxyl group designated as 1,3-diol. 


So the IUPAC name of the given compound is 2-Methylpropane-1,3-diol.


The answer is option A.

What is the $IUPAC$ name of the following compound?


$CH _{3} - CH _{2} - CH _{2} - OH$

  1. Propan-1-ol

  2. Propan-2-ol

  3. Propane-1-ol

  4. Ethane-2-ol

Reveal answer Fill a bubble to check yourself
A Correct answer
Explanation

In this compound, the number of carbon atoms is 3. So, the parent alkane is propane. 


The functional group present is $-OH$ i.e alcohol. $-OH$ is present at the first carbon atom 

Thus the IUPAC name is Propan - 1 - ol.

The IUPAC name for $CH _3CH(OH)CH _2C(CH _3) _2OH$ is:

  1. 1, 1-dimethyl-1,3-butanediol

  2. 2-methyl-2,4 pentanediol

  3. 4-methyl-2 4-pentanediol

  4. 1,3,3- trimethyl 1-1,3-propanediol

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

The compound has 2 alcohol groups at C-2 positions on both the sides. From this point we can not say from where to start numbering. But if we number from right hand side there is also a methyl group at C-2 position. So we start number from right hand side.
Since there are two alcoholic group, we use suffix "diol"
Thus IUPAC name is: 2-Methyl-2,4 pentanediol

IUPAC name of the compound $CH _3-CH(CH _2CH _3)-CH _2-CH(OH)-CH _3$ is:

  1. 4-Ethyl-2-pentanol

  2. 4-Methyl-2-hexanol

  3. 2-Ethyl-2-pentanol

  4. 3-Ethyl-2-hexanol

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

Longest carbon chain has 6 atoms. We number from right hand side as alcohol group at C-2 gets least number in this case and suffix used for alcohol is "-ol". Methyl group is present at C-4 position.

Thus, IUPAC name is 4-Methyl-2-hexanol.

6-(4-Hydroxy-3 Methyl-trans-2-butenylamine) purine is also called

  1. Methyl jasmonate

  2. Zeatin

  3. Brasinolide

  4. Triacontanol

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

A 6-(4-Hydroxy-3 Methyl-trans-2-butenylamine) purine is a chemical name of trans zeatin. It is a type of cytokinin, plant hormone. It was first found in Zea maize. It stimulates the cell division process in plants. It acts as plant growth regulator.

Thus, the correct answer is option B.
